my QR on my GMC SIERRA lists Z71 Off Road Suspension  BUT my Bed Emblem says X31

 

 

 

 

That's because X31 = Z71.  The option code is Z71 regardless.  Same mechanicals too, its just marketed on Chevrolet as the "Z71 Off Road Suspension" and on GMC is marketed as the "X31 Off Road Suspension."

 

X31 is its own RPO code as well which is "off road appearance package" so just the "look" of X31.  Mechanicals its still a Z71.  Chevy uses WEA for "off road appearance package".

Is X31 the same as Z71?
google says:
google says: lol
The X31 package is the GMC equivalent of the Z71 off-road package available for the Chevy Silverado. As such, it will include similar equipment including off-road suspension, hill descent control, skid plates, auto-locking rear differentials, a 2-speed transfer case, and rear wheelhouse liners.
